【4/7 Seminar】 WPI-Bio2Q Open Seminar: Augustinas Silale, Ph.D.(for Keio Members)

March 17, 2026

Keio University Human Biology-Microbiome-Quantum Research Center (WPI-Bio2Q) will hold a seminar as follows.
This event is only for faculty, students, and staff of Keio University.

Date & Time Tuesday, April 7, 2026, 17:00-18:00
Venue JKiC 1F, Shinanomachi Campus, Keio University (Onsite only)
Title Energised transport across the outer membrane in gut microbiota
Speaker Augustinas Silale, Ph.D.
Research Associate, Biosciences Institute, Newcastle University, UK
Language English
Poster PDF
Pre-registration Not required (Only Keio University members can attend.)
